2026.03.2019:30:00UTC+00Speculators Trim Bullish Bets on U.S. Crude Oil, CFTC Data Show

Speculative net long positions in U.S. crude oil futures declined in the latest reporting period, according to data released by the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) on 20 March 2026. Net speculative positions eased to 218.7K, down from 228.0K previously.

The reduction suggests that money managers and other speculative traders have slightly pared back their bullish exposure to crude, potentially reflecting increased caution over the near-term price outlook or changing risk appetite in energy markets. While positioning remains net long overall, the pullback indicates a modest cooling in speculative optimism toward U.S. oil futures.
